OVRSEA joins Bolloré Group

Bolloré Group acquires a majority stake in the digital freight forwarder OVRSEA, a startup launched 3 years ago by three HEC Paris alumni within the X-HEC Startup Launchpad.

Ovrsea

"It's a major achievement" explained Arthur Barillas, co-founder of Ovrsea when announcing that Bolloré Logistics was taking a majority stake in the startup.

This merger will enable OVRSEA to open up to new markets, thanks to Bolloré Logistics’ experience and its network of worldwide locations, while maintaining its philosophy, management and staff.

For its part, Bolloré Logistics will be able to broaden its range of services and offer a 100% digital experience to its customers thanks to next-generation technologies.

Ovrsea, was launched 3 years ago by three HEC Alumni from the Digital Major Arthur Barillas, Mathieu Mattei and Brieuc André, a team completed by 2 other co-founders Georges Semaan and Antoine Sauvage, who followed the acceleration program of the X-HEC-42 Startup Launchpad, then developed the solution during 2 years in the Incubateur HEC Paris, at Station F.
 
"We envisioned a company that would redefine our industry and become a leader in freight transportation and supply chain solutions. "

OVRSEA is a French digital freight forwarder that simplifies and optimizes international transport for companies. The startup coordinates all operations and digitalizes processes thanks to a unique and innovative management platform: from quotation to invoicing, and providing real-time tracking of goods.

OVRSEA has more than 40 employees, is present in 60 countries and works with more than 500 clients including Devialet, Nuxe or Yves Rocher.

By the end of the year, they intend to recruit more than 50 people across 15 positions (sales, product, sales operations, operations, development, finance, administration); to penetrate new markets in Europe, North America and Asia; to move into new offices (more than 700m2 near Montmartre).

The architects of the startup's success remain more committed than ever to writing this new chapter as the company plans to double its workforce by the end of the year, and, by 2025, OVRSEA aims at reaching a turnover of 200 million euros.

Ovrsea in figures

1.9M raised in 2019 (Kima, BPI + BA) 
45 employees  
500 customers, of which +30% outside France 
Turnover tripled during Covid  
Some examples of clients : Devialet, Caudalie, Nuxe, Palladium, IZIPIZI, COWBOY etc...
